NGO Open Day at Waitakere Hospital—Everyone Welcome

In conjunction with a “WDHB Patient Experience” Focus

11am to 2pm, Wednesday 25th March 2015

Waitakere Health Link continues the ‘Open Days’ this year, connecting hospital staff with health services in the community. Hosting two Hospital Open Days each year enable Waitakere Hospital staff to meet and network with organisations who provide health services to patients leaving hospital and support them to stay well in the community. The Open Days are well attended, attracting new organisations each time.
